Mechanical processing is the process of changing the shape and size of parts using various tools and machines. Imagine a piece of metal or plastic - raw material that needs to be turned into the part you need. For this, machining is used. A variety of processing methods
There are many methods of machining, each with their own advantages and features. For example, turning is when a rotating tool cuts the chips from the surface of the part, making it cylindrical or conical. Milling - as if we cut the part on the surface with a knife, creating complex shapes. Grinding is a subtle leveling and polishing of the surface, giving it smoothness and accuracy. There are other methods such as drilling, cutting threads, boring and many others, each of which is needed to solve certain problems. The choice of a specific method depends on the shape of the part, the required accuracy, material and affordable equipment.
Quality is the key to success
The quality of mechanical processing directly affects the durability and performance of the finished part. If the surface is unprofitable, it can be uneven, have burrs, which can lead to premature wear or even breakdown of the product in the future. Uneven surfaces can lead to premature wear. Exactly processed parts work more stable, provide more smooth operation of the mechanisms and extend their service life. Materials and tools
Various materials and tools are used for machining. The choice of material depends on the characteristics of the processed part - strength, hardness, resistance to corrosion. The tools are also selected for the material and shape of the part. For example, for the processing of solid alloys, we need tools with high hardness. The right choice of materials and tools is the key to high -quality and effective processing, and not only safety, but also the rational use of resources.
